Pros

Good training, flexible with work schedule, good benefits, perks and incentives. Multicultural environment with new immigrants being recruited and supported.

Cons

Long extended hours. Not enough support from senior management. Sales was always a priority with service taking a side burner.

Pros

Wide range of opportunities and exposure to other business units especially in Toronto because of the size and proximity of different departments. Get certain financial benefits from being an employee.

Cons

When looking to move, it depends on how accepting your boss is. They can scuttle your plans quickly. Compared to other financial institutions, the financial benefits are not as significant. There is a tendency to move senior executives into different areas even though they do not have applicable backgrounds.
